oooh look what i found from XDA
"The fix has been working on JVK and JVB ROMs, check other threads about this issue. You can delete the data of the Software Update application, but it will be regenerated after a reboot. If you want to get rid of this, just root the phone and delete the following APKs syncmldm.apk syncmlds.apk wssyncmlnps.apk Just look at this: After 17 hours with light usage, still 68% battery." anybody tried this before? |

Someone found out how to completely fix ur GPS problem.
http://forum.xda-developers.com/showthread.php?t=1043034 all u have to do is remove ur SGS casing and press lightly(put pressure) on the top of ur gps antenna(to the right of the speaker) so what this guy did was he applied some double sided tape at the top of the antenna i tried pressing the top of the gps antenna and immediately locked up to 12 sats. sorry for the bad pic, i couldnt screen cap just now. |
